Lot 11

A late Victorian 15ct gold citrine and split pearl brooch, circa 1880.

Description

Condition Report

A late Victorian 15ct gold citrine and split pearl brooch, circa 1880. The graduated circular-shape citrine collet line, with split pearl accent scrolling sides. Length 3.7cms. Weight 4gms.

  • Overall condition good. Surface scratches and minor discolouration in keeping with general wear.

  • Some wear to mount possible replacement gems.

  • Citrine well matched.

  • Citrine medium dark slightly brownish-orange, well saturated, with good to fair clarity and typical inclusions.

  • Citrine are in good to fair condition with some abrasion and minor nibbles to the girdle and facet edges.

  • Split pearls well matched.

  • Split pearls white, with pinkish overtones and fair lustre.

  • Split pearls in good condition with some minor abrasions.

  • Stamped 15ct.
